DCHC RMN: New Trade Union Rights - Fundamental Reform to Workplace Relations

Trade unions are acquiring statutory rights to access your care services to meet, represent and recruit workers to join the union and thresholds for unions to gain formal recognition and collective bargaining rights have been reduced. This will fundamentally change workforce relations and your pay and reward strategy. Care providers of all sizes are affected, and many are already receiving requests from unions so being proactive and developing a strategy now is essential.       

This webinar from James Sage, Employment Partner in RWK Goodman’s Health & Social Care team, will provide practical guidance on:

  • The new right to access
  • Formal recognition and collective bargaining
  • Developing a trade union strategy
  • Negotiating access and collective bargaining agreements
  • The operational and financial implications of the reforms
